princess shokora
The true ruler of the Golden Pyramid and the damsel in distress in Wario Land 4. Long ago she was peacefully laid to rest under the pyramid until the Golden Diva, in her greed, took residence of the pyramid, all of its treasures and cursed the ruins, transforming Shokora into a shape-shifting entity.
She shares some design elements with Princess Peach, having a golden crown, blue eyes, blue sphere earrings, and a pink long dress with puffy short sleeves. She also has long reddish hair (more pinkish in the in-game sprite), wears golden bangles and pink elbow gloves.
Depending on the number of chests Wario has collected, the design Shokora will transform into will differ. If one or no chests were collected, she turns into a baby. If two to five chests were collected, she appears as a large, hideous woman with a big nose, resembling Wario's ugly face. If six to eleven chests were collected, she appears a young woman with long hair and a princess's dress, resembling her official art. If all twelve chests were collected, her true form is shown as a slender and matured woman with shorter hair and a cape. See asset #24265333 for a look at every form Shokora can take in the ending.
The word Shokora derives from the French word for "Chocolate".
